Brief Summary
The purpose of this study is to evaluate the efficacy, safety, and pharmacokinetics of HS-20106 on anemia in patients with very low, low or intermediate risk MDS.

Eligibility Criteria
Inclusion
- Diagnosis of MDS according to World Health Organization (WHO) classification that meets Revised International Prognostic Scoring System (IPSS-R) classification of very low, low, or intermediate risk disease(IPSS-R ≤ 3.5).
- \< 5% blasts in bone marrow and \< 1% blasts in peripheral blood.
- Each cohort is defined as:
- Cohort 1: In NTD participants, having received no red blood cell (RBC) transfusions within 16 weeks Hgb concentration between 60 and 100g/L.
- Cohort 2: In LTB participants, having received an average of \< 4 units of RBC transfused within 8 weeks (i.e., total blood transfused over 16 weeks/2) Hgb concentration between 60 and 100 g/L.
- In HTB participants, having received an average of ≥ 4 units of RBC transfused within 8 weeks (i.e., total blood transfused over 16 weeks/2) Hgb concentration between 60 and 100 g/L.
- Eastern Cooperative Oncology Group (ECOG) performance status of 0, 1, or 2 (if related to anemia.
- Females of child-bearing potential and sexually active males must agree to use effective methods of contraception.
Exclusion
- Chromosome 5q deletion, del (5q).
- Anemia caused by other reasons, such as iron deficiency anemia, megaloblastic anemia, aplastic anemia, renal anemia or blood loss.
- Diagnosis of secondary MDS (i.e., MDS known to have arisen as the result of chemical injury or treatment with chemotherapy and/or radiation for other diseases).
- Prior treatment with azacitidine, decitabine, lenalidomide, luspatercept, or sotatercept.
